1. Set Up Your Chart of Accounts Properly

A properly structured chart of accounts is the cornerstone of effective accounting in Sage 50.

Recommendations:

Match your account structure with your industry standards Use uniform numbering conventions (e.g., 1000-1999 for assets) Create accounts that reflect your tax reporting requirements Avoid excessive sub-accounts that complicate reporting Review and prune unused accounts annually

2. Implement a Consistent Data Entry Routine

Regular data entry reduces errors and guarantees accurate financial reporting.

Best Practices:

Enter transactions weekly rather than quarterly Use descriptive memos for all entries Assign transactions to the correct accounting period Match bank accounts monthly Set reminders for regular transactions

3. Utilize Sage 50's Automation Features

Sage 50 offers numerous automation tools to increase efficiency.

Automation Tools to Use:

Recurring Transactions: For regular invoices and bills Bank Feeds: Automatically import bank transactions Default Templates: For common invoices and forms Batch Entry: Process multiple transactions simultaneously Rules: Automatically categorize transactions

4. Establish Proper Documentation Procedures

Good documentation backs up your financial records and simplifies audits.

Documentation Best Practices:

Attach electronic copies of invoices to transactions Use the notes field to record important details Maintain a uniform file naming convention Store backups of supporting documents offsite Record all journal entry explanations

5. Frequently Reconcile Accounts

Frequent reconciliation ensures your Sage 50 data aligns with external records.

Reconciliation Best Practices:

Reconcile bank accounts within 30 days Review outstanding transactions weekly Investigate and resolve discrepancies immediately Use the native reconciliation tool in Sage 50 Keep detailed reconciliation records

6. Adapt Reports to Your Business Needs

Sage 50's flexible reporting features can provide insightful business intelligence.

Reporting Optimization Tips:

Customize default reports to show important data Create project-specific profit and loss reports Set up saved report templates for regular use Schedule regular report generation and distribution Use detailed capabilities to investigate anomalies

7. Implement Strong Security Protocols

Protecting your financial data is crucial for compliance.

Protection Best Practices:

Set up tiered user permissions Require strong passwords that change regularly Limit access to sensitive financial data Maintain an audit trail of all changes Remove access for former employees immediately

8. Perform Regular Maintenance

Periodic maintenance ensures your Sage 50 data clean.

Maintenance Tasks:

Check data integrity regularly Compact your data files periodically Audit vendor and customer lists for duplicates Archive old transactions as needed Test backups regularly

9. Stay Current with Updates and Training

Recent Sage 50 versions often include valuable features and improvements.

Update Recommendations:

Install Sage 50 support 50 updates when available Learn about new features in each release Take advantage of Sage's learning materials Attend training sessions for advanced features Join Sage user communities to share tips

10. Establish a Backup and Disaster Recovery Plan

Protecting your Sage 50 data from corruption is critical.

Backup Best Practices:

Perform daily automated backups Store backups offsite Test backup restoration quarterly Maintain multiple backup generations Document your recovery procedures
